&lt;div&gt;Regards,&lt;br /&gt;Handy&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</description></item><item><title>WebGrid with BatchUpdate not leaving EditMode after button is clicked</title><link>http://www.intersoftsolutions.com/Community/WebGrid/WebGrid-with-BatchUpdate-not-leaving-EditMode-after-button-is-clicked/</link><pubDate>Wed, 06 Oct 2010 15:30:12 GMT</pubDate><dc:creator>SAgosto</dc:creator><description>&lt;p&gt;I can't seem to reproduce this but some of our users are reporting data that is entered in a WebGrid is not persisting to the database. It's not consistant or reproducible that I have found.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;br /&gt;I have a button that creates a WebGrid NewRow and defaults some data. There is validation at the RowValidate event and when the user clicks the Save button which prompts the user to enter the required fields before allowing a postback. I have seen the following: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t; &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The user enter data and then get a validation message stating that a field is required (it was not filled in) yet data was definately in the field. After clicking the Save button again, the page is posted but the data is not saved. This means that the validation DID pass but ultimately was not in the Server-Side GetChanges list.  This is odd because the fact that the Grid did see all the required fields as being populated except one. Then, the clicking of the Save button passed validation meaning the last field was found yet no data at all was saved? In this situation, the row had the EDIT icon meaning it never went back to the ADD ICON meaning the data was saved on the client before posting back.&lt;/p&gt;
